NOx sensors play a crucial role in the automotive industry, particularly in the context of emissions control systems. These sensors are designed to detect nitrogen oxides (NOx) in exhaust gases, which are harmful pollutants resulting from combustion processes in engines. Their primary function is to monitor and measure the concentration of NOx emissions, enabling vehicles to comply with stringent environmental regulations.
The operation of NOx sensors involves the use of advanced sensing technologies. Most commonly, these sensors utilize a combination of zirconia and titania-based materials to achieve accurate readings of NOx levels. When integrated into a vehicle’s exhaust system, they provide real-time data to the engine control unit (ECU), allowing for precise adjustments to the fuel-air mixture in the combustion chamber. By optimizing the combustion process, NOx sensors help reduce harmful emissions, improve fuel efficiency, and enhance overall engine performance.
In addition to their core function of emissions monitoring, NOx sensors also contribute to the operation of various after-treatment systems, such as selective catalytic reduction (SCR) and lean nox traps. In SCR systems, for instance, the data from NOx sensors helps determine the correct amount of reductant agent—usually urea solution—needed to convert NOx emissions into harmless nitrogen and water. This integration is critical for achieving compliance with regulatory standards and minimizing environmental impact.
The importance of NOx sensors is further underscored by the growing emphasis on sustainable practices within the automotive sector. As governments worldwide implement stricter emissions regulations, the demand for reliable and efficient NOx sensors continues to rise. Manufacturers are investing in innovative technologies to enhance the accuracy, durability, and overall performance of these sensors, ensuring they can withstand the harsh conditions of automotive environments.
Moreover, the role of NOx sensors extends beyond traditional combustion engines. With the advent of hybrid and electric vehicles, understanding NOx emissions remains vital as these vehicles still rely on internal combustion engines for operation in certain conditions. Thus, NOx sensors are integral not only for compliance but also for advancing the development of cleaner technologies.
